Abstract
The proton spin crisis remains an unsolved problem in physics. In this paper we find that due to the confinement of partons inside the hadron the angular momentum sum rule in QCD is violated. Hence we find that the non-vanishing angular momentum flux contribution of the partons in QCD should be added to the spin and angular momentum of the partons to solve the proton spin crisis.
